Executive-ready slides, one API call away. Send a JSON intermediate representation (IR) or a natural-language prompt and get back a .pptx file, Google Slides deck, or thumbnail PNG -- with professional layout, consistent branding, and verified quality.
Features
- 32 slide types -- title, agenda, bullet points, comparison, timeline, process flow, org chart, stats callout, table, chart, matrix, funnel, map, and more
- 9 finance-specific slides -- DCF summary, comp table, waterfall chart, deal overview, returns analysis, capital structure, market landscape, risk matrix, investment thesis
- 24 chart types -- bar, line, area, pie, donut, scatter, bubble, combo, waterfall, funnel, treemap, radar, tornado, football field, sensitivity table, heatmap, sankey, gantt, sunburst, and more
- 15 built-in themes -- corporate-blue, executive-dark, finance-pro, modern-gradient, minimal-light, tech-neon, and 9 others (plus custom brand kits)
- Native PPTX output -- python-pptx rendering with element-level control, transitions, and chart embedding
- Google Slides output -- direct export via Google Slides API (OAuth flow included)
- AI content generation -- natural-language to slides via Claude, OpenAI, Gemini, or Ollama (4-stage pipeline: intent, outline, expand, refine)
- 5-pass QA pipeline -- automated quality checks with auto-fix engine for contrast, overflow, alignment, and more
- Constraint-based layout -- kiwisolver constraint solver, 12-column grid, adaptive overflow (font reduce, reflow, split)
- MCP server -- 6 tools for AI agent integration (render, generate, themes, slide types, estimate, preview)
- x402 machine payments -- per-call USDC pricing on Base L2 for autonomous AI agents
- Stripe billing -- subscription tiers (Starter free, Pro $79/mo, Enterprise custom) with credit system
- TypeScript SDK --
@deckforge/sdkwith fluent builder pattern, full type safety, SSE streaming
Quick Start
Get from zero to your first rendered deck in under 5 minutes.
Prerequisites
- Docker and Docker Compose
- Git
Steps
# 1. Clone the repo
git clone https://github.com/Whatsonyourmind/deckforge && cd deckforge
# 2. Copy environment config (works out of the box for local dev)
cp .env.example .env
# 3. Start all services (API, workers, PostgreSQL, Redis, MinIO)
docker compose up -d
# 4. Initialize the database (runs migrations, seeds test user + API key)
bash scripts/bootstrap-db.sh
# 5. Verify the API is running
curl http://localhost:8000/v1/health
# => {"status":"healthy"}
The bootstrap script outputs a test API key (dk_test_...). Save it for the examples below.
API Examples
Render a deck from IR
curl -X POST http://localhost:8000/v1/render \
-H "Authorization: Bearer dk_test_YOUR_KEY_HERE" \
-H "Content-Type: application/json" \
-d '{
"title": "Q4 Board Update",
"theme": "corporate-blue",
"slides": [
{
"slide_type": "title_slide",
"elements": [
{"type": "title", "content": "Q4 2026 Board Update"},
{"type": "subtitle", "content": "Acme Corp -- Confidential"}
]
},
{
"slide_type": "stats_callout",
"elements": [
{"type": "title", "content": "Key Metrics"},
{"type": "metric", "content": "$4.2M", "label": "ARR"},
{"type": "metric", "content": "142%", "label": "YoY Growth"},
{"type": "metric", "content": "94%", "label": "Retention"}
]
}
]
}' \
--output board-update.pptx
Generate a deck from natural language
curl -X POST http://localhost:8000/v1/generate \
-H "Authorization: Bearer dk_test_YOUR_KEY_HERE" \
-H "Content-Type: application/json" \
-d '{
"prompt": "Create a 10-slide pitch deck for a B2B SaaS startup in the cybersecurity space, Series A, $2M ARR",
"theme": "executive-dark",
"output_format": "pptx"
}' \
--output pitch-deck.pptx
Note: The
/v1/generateendpoint requires at least one LLM API key configured in.env(Anthropic, OpenAI, Gemini, or Ollama).
Check available themes and slide types
# List all 15 themes
curl http://localhost:8000/v1/themes
# List all 32 slide types with example IR
curl http://localhost:8000/v1/slide-types
# Estimate credit cost before rendering
curl -X POST http://localhost:8000/v1/estimate \
-H "Authorization: Bearer dk_test_YOUR_KEY_HERE" \
-H "Content-Type: application/json" \
-d '{"slides": [{"slide_type": "title_slide"}, {"slide_type": "chart_slide"}]}'

Deployment
Fly.io (Recommended)
DeckForge ships with a production-ready fly.toml and multi-stage Dockerfile.
# 1. Install Fly CLI
curl -L https://fly.io/install.sh | sh
# 2. Login and launch
fly auth login
fly launch --name deckforge-api --region iad
# 3. Provision PostgreSQL
fly postgres create --name deckforge-db --region iad
fly postgres attach deckforge-db
# 4. Provision Redis (via Upstash or Fly Redis)
fly redis create --name deckforge-redis
# Copy the REDIS_URL from output
# 5. Set production secrets
fly secrets set \
DECKFORGE_ENVIRONMENT=production \
DECKFORGE_DEBUG=false \
DECKFORGE_DATABASE_URL="postgres://..." \
DECKFORGE_REDIS_URL="redis://..." \
DECKFORGE_S3_ENDPOINT_URL="https://..." \
DECKFORGE_S3_ACCESS_KEY="..." \
DECKFORGE_S3_SECRET_KEY="..." \
DECKFORGE_S3_BUCKET="deckforge" \
DECKFORGE_STRIPE_SECRET_KEY="sk_live_..." \
DECKFORGE_STRIPE_WEBHOOK_SECRET="whsec_..." \
DECKFORGE_ANTHROPIC_API_KEY="sk-ant-..."
# 6. Deploy
fly deploy
# 7. Run database migrations
fly ssh console -C "alembic upgrade head"
# 8. Verify
curl https://deckforge-api.fly.dev/v1/health
Fly.io configuration highlights:
- 2 shared CPUs, 1 GB RAM per VM
- Auto-stop/start for cost efficiency (min 1 machine running)
- Forced HTTPS with concurrency limits (200 soft / 250 hard)
- Multi-process:
api(uvicorn) +worker(ARQ)
Docker Compose (Local Development)
# Start all 6 services
docker compose up -d
# Services:
# api - FastAPI + uvicorn (port 8000)
# content-worker - ARQ worker for NL-to-IR generation
# render-worker - ARQ worker for IR-to-PPTX rendering
# postgres - PostgreSQL 16 (port 5432)
# redis - Redis 7 (port 6379)
# minio - MinIO S3-compatible storage (port 9000, console 9001)
# Check service health
docker compose ps
# View API logs
docker compose logs -f api
# Tear down (preserves data volumes)
docker compose down
# Full reset (removes data)
docker compose down -v
S3 Storage Options
| Environment | Provider | Config |
|---|---|---|
| Local dev | MinIO (via Docker Compose) | Default .env.example values |
| Production | Cloudflare R2 | Set S3_ENDPOINT_URL, S3_ACCESS_KEY, S3_SECRET_KEY |
| Production | AWS S3 | Set S3_ENDPOINT_URL to AWS endpoint |
| Fly.io | Fly Tigris | fly storage create, auto-configured |
Pricing
Subscription Tiers
| Tier | Price | Credits/month | Rate Limit | Best For |
|---|---|---|---|---|
| Starter | Free | 50 | 10 req/min | Evaluation, hobby projects |
| Pro | $79/month | 500 | 60 req/min | Teams, production apps |
| Enterprise | Custom | 10,000+ | 300 req/min | High-volume, overage allowed |
Credit Cost
Each API call consumes credits based on complexity:
- Simple render (< 5 slides): 1 credit
- Standard render (5-20 slides): 2-3 credits
- Complex render (charts, finance slides): 3-5 credits
- Content generation (NL-to-IR): +2 credits (LLM usage)
x402 Per-Call Pricing (AI Agents)
For autonomous AI agents that prefer pay-per-call over subscriptions:
| Endpoint | USDC Price | Network |
|---|---|---|
/v1/render |
$0.05 | Base L2 |
/v1/generate |
$0.15 | Base L2 |
| Metadata endpoints | Free | -- |
x402 payments bypass rate limiting (per-call payment is self-throttling).
